In Which I Take a Rainy Woodland Walk Near Findon Valley

The sunshine may be over for a while but it should stop us enjoying the wondeful countryside in spring time.

I have taken a short woodland walk up a track near Findon in West Sussex, just north of Worthing, on the South Downs. Just bursting into bloom are elder trees and hawthorn. We still have bluebells too.

A simple walk today in the wet, glistening, green lane in Sussex. I hope you enjoy it.
